What is Predictive Analytics?
Predictive analytics is a branch of advanced analytics that uses statistical algorithms and machine learning techniques to identify the likelihood of future outcomes based on historical data. Retailers leverage predictive analytics to:
- Forecast demand: By analyzing past sales data, retailers can predict future product demand.
- Optimize inventory: Predictive models help in determining the optimal stock levels needed to meet consumer demand without overstocking.
- Enhance customer experience: By understanding customer behavior, retailers can tailor their offerings to better meet individual customer needs.

Key Applications of Predictive Analytics in Retail Logistics
Inventory Management
Predictive analytics helps retailers manage their inventory levels by anticipating demand fluctuations. By leveraging historical sales data, seasonality, and trends, analytics tools can predict which items will be in demand and when, enabling retailers to adjust their stock levels accordingly. This not only reduces the risk of stockouts but also minimizes holding costs associated with excess inventory.
Demand Forecasting
With the help of machine learning algorithms, retailers can forecast product demand with greater accuracy. This allows them to strategize on production and procurement, ensuring that the right products are available at the right time. Accurate demand forecasting is crucial in India's diverse market, where consumer behaviors can dramatically change based on various factors such as festivals, holidays, and trends.
Delivery Route Optimization
Predictive analytics can enhance logistics by optimizing delivery routes based on real-time traffic data, weather forecasts, and historical delivery times. By identifying the most efficient routes, retailers can reduce fuel costs, improve delivery times, and enhance customer satisfaction. For instance, Indian e-commerce companies heavily rely on such analytics to ensure timely deliveries, especially in urban areas with heavy congestion.
Supplier Relationship Management
Data-driven insights can also help retailers strengthen relationships with suppliers. By analyzing supplier performance, retailers can predict supply delays, quality issues, or other challenges. This allows them to take proactive measures and negotiate better terms with suppliers, ensuring a smoother supply chain.
Challenges in Implementing Predictive Analytics in Retail Logistics
While the benefits are substantial, several challenges may arise when implementing predictive analytics in retail logistics in India:
- Data Quality: For predictive analytics to be effective, high-quality data is essential. Inconsistent or incomplete data can lead to inaccurate predictions.
- Integration with Existing Systems: Many retailers work with legacy systems that may not be compatible with advanced analytics solutions, creating integration challenges.
- Skill Gap: There is often a shortage of skilled data scientists and analysts who understand predictive analytics, leading to a gap in successful implementation.
